常常时候svn可能会遇到这种状况(好比今天 - -):ide
svn failed: 远程主机强迫关闭了一个现有的链接.svn
致使这个问题 须要检查:ip
1.svn服务是否正常 it
#ps aux|grep svn class
root 14422 0.0 0.0 156892 888 ? Ss 11:39 0:00 svnserve -d -r /data/svndata/配置
重启服务:grep
#kill -9 14422配置文件
#svnserve -d -r /data/svndata/ #svnserve是要加入PATH全局的,提示不存在就进入svn目录执行项目
2.端口3690(默认)是否正常 word
#telnet ip 3690
3.项目的版本库配置文件 conf下的3个文件是否正确:
auth:
不要把成员都加入进[groups]的admin,好比admin=aa,bb,cc。这样也会致使错误
admin只须要写一个用户(不绝对)
而后在最下面加入:
[版本库名称:/]
aa = rw
bb = rw
password:
[users]
aa = xxx
bb = xxx
svnserve.conf:
这个文件要注意 最好在每一个配置开头都不要用空格。